## Formula sandbox tuning

User-supplied formulas in Gridmoor execute inside a restricted interpreter with hard ceilings on time, memory, and call depth. Reviewers should confirm any change to these ceilings is justified in the PR description, since raising them widens the abuse surface. Defaults were chosen from production traces. The current limits are as follows.

limits module of tafog-fawip:
WEIGHTS = {
    "julix": 57,
    "lamys": 992,
    "kasvan": 209,
    "quenok": 750,
    "alddor": 259,
    "oliath": 1009,
    "wenix": 815,
}

- [ ] **Step 7: Breaker override escrow.** After sealing the signing keys for the Tallgrove upstream API circuit breaker, confirm the support team can force the breaker open during a full outage. The override bundle lives in the sealed escrow drawer and is useless without its unlock phrase. Two ceremony witnesses must initial this step before proceeding. The escrow bundle is decrypted with the recovery passphrase that follows.

vault phrase of kahip-kahop = holath-quenmir

Subject: Marketing Budget Adjustment — Q4

Dear executive team,

Following the revenue shortfall in the Aldermoor region, we are reducing the marketing budget by 14% for Q4. Branch managers should pause discretionary campaigns and protect only committed sponsorships. Detailed reallocation guidance will follow next week from the Verity Row office. The reasoning behind this decision is summarised in the note below.

internal memo for kaduf-baduf: Only 35 of the 378 pilot accounts renewed Holir, so a churn review is set for June 11. Eliielax Group is in early talks to buy Silaelix Group for about $142.1 million.

**Action item (PM-114, Quillgate outage):** Hey, welcome aboard! Quick context: our load balancer kept routing to half-dead Brindlefox nodes because the health check only pinged the port, not the app. Fix is to switch to the /deep-health endpoint and tighten the probe cadence. The agreed timing and threshold constants are listed below.

constants for tageg-kagag:
QUOTAS = {
    "kelax": 495,
    "istath": 366,
    "tammir": 108,
    "novdor": 730,
    "casax": 816,
    "quenael": 874,
    "pelius": 403,
}